On 29 October Schuman Associates together with the Lithuanian Presidency of the Council of the European Union and the international audit and accounting network BDO organised a Panel Discussion on Smart Regulation for SMEs, attended by Brussels based European business organisations, representatives of companies from around Europe, EU institutions and diplomats. The event focused on the impact of regulation to medium sized enterprises in Europe and possible ways to reduce regulatory burden.

On 27th November 2013, Danish MEP Bendt Bendtsen co-hosted a breakfast briefing in the European Parliament with BDO International. The briefing on access to finance for European companies focused on the specific needs of the European mid-sized companies with regards to funding as well as generally addressing their challenges when it comes to growth.
